What is the solution to the equation-4x - 14 = 6?

    x=-5

    Step-by-step explanation:

    -4x - 14 = 6

    Add 14 to each side

    -4x - 14+14 = 6+14

    -4x = 20

    Divide each side by - 4

    -4x/-4 = 20/-4

    x = - 5
